Type
ORACLE
Validation date
2025-01-16 02:03: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01674,
    "usd": 0.01723
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D154791E799C830F546171061CE76968B64EB72287A40A884BE5F75F4D45D857

Previous signature

C2739E87659B419148604969C4A4BF4EDA0086378EDBF20F2BA3064E3D7058B438ABD2884052B7AA1D70105C7CCCCDF5405EF30FD2931EBF992FFA9B9EC3610F

Origin signature

3044022044A72FB1B82F74E5004EA43023963E26461EF276FFC458B9AC96BFEC8D357B7A02206CB532A564C9912469B257B6F7B44D0876E636AF850AC720D51D7E538FDC2CA1

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0028B51F867E3F02C7B137AFE043CC6C624ED0023A30DFF014047B0DB34DAF8888

Coordinator signature

71768E249E6CBDA041072D12684FBAD6A57D701623CD91531612F9B42590DD9EED5FD93742985D973127D337E869C5F0EA3CAEAAFF7846E9E3B8DDB5567C5C0B

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

1611D8910EA521E31C99C07E5388957BB88D334EB7693F5EBBCE0911A8B7A049A44055EC0DBC20136185B28571F6195A0602C34E5E769CD670A790D56E6C9804

Validator #2 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#2 signature

C37B9E6F6B86D138D15933DC61C5E5E99BFE4B4707DB00A0E06F59728D3BF855A2D03D0C1F28AD3B61361D8D5A5ACA6B3389F9B30ECC5AB099113880C9B8410E